Jake Hiller Dr. Hiller is currently honored as the Donald and Rose Ann Tomasini Assistant Professor of Transportation Engineering in the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ering at Michigan Tech. His research interests focus on the interaction between materials, mechanics, and performance in concrete pavements. Dr. Hiller also teaches courses in pavements, construction materials, and transportation-related topics.

Dr. Hiller has been awarded fellowships from the Federal Highway Administration’s Eisenhower Transportation program, the Portland Cement Association, and the Illinois Chapter of the American Concrete Pavement Association. He has been active in the International Society for Concrete Pavements, the Transportation Research Board, and with several other international activities in the field of pavements. He has also published his research work in the Journal of the Transportation Research Board, ASCE Journal of Transportation Engineering, ASCE Journal of Performance of Constructed Facilities , ACI Materials Journal, as well as several conference proceedings.
